Part 1: Do P47 Headphones Actually Need a Driver on Windows 7? Let’s clear up a widespread misconception. The P47 headphones are standard Bluetooth headphones . They use the A2DP (Advanced Audio Distribution Profile) protocol. Windows 7 does not natively support Bluetooth audio as seamlessly as Windows 10 or 11.
